> Also, when closing bugs that were fixed in an upload that was already > done, please use a Version pseudo-header. Sending a message to > [EMAIL PROTECTED] without the Version pseudo-header is > equivalent to marking the bug as invalid. I've fixed this by sending > "fixed 438296 1.07-1" to [EMAIL PROTECTED] Sorry for my mistakes, I just send the 438296-done to the BTS, then I recieve the "marked as done" email that I doubt it is finished.
